Neptis woodwardi is a butterfly in the Nymphalidae family. It is found in Uganda and Kenya.[2]
Subspecies
- Neptis woodwardi woodwardi (Kenya: west of the Rift Valley, eastern Uganda)
- Neptis woodwardi translima Collins & Larsen, 1991 (Kenya: central highlands)
